License authorizing the New Zealand Co-operative Dairy
Company (Limited) to erect Electric Lines at Frankton
Junction.
JELLICOE, Governor-General.
ORDER IN COUNCIL.
At the Government House at Wellington, this 12th day of
September, 1921.
Present:
IN pursuance and exercise of the powers conferred by the
Public Works Amendment Act, 1911, and of all other
powers in anyway enabling him in that behalf, His Excellency
the Governor-General of the Dominion of New Zealand,
acting by and with the advice and consent of the Executive
Council of the said Dominion, doth—subject to the con-
ditions set forth in the Schedule hereto, and to the regulations
made under section two of the aforesaid Act, and dated the
twenty-second day of September, one thousand nine hundred
and nineteen, and published in the New Zealand Gazette of
the twenty-fifth day of the same month, or any regulations
hereafter made in amendment thereof or in substitution
therefor (and hereinafter collectively referred to as “the
regulations”), and which regulations shall be deemed to be
incorporated herein—hereby authorize the New Zealand
Co-operative Dairy Company (Limited), (hereinafter referred
to as “the licensee”) to erect and maintain electric lines
for lighting, power, and heating purposes along the route
described in the Schedule hereto.
SCHEDULE.
- ROUTE OF ELECTRIC LINES.
That route commencing at the power-station in Section 83,
Pukete Parish, and running in a south-easterly direction
generally through portion of the said Section 83, across
Norton Road, through Section 7A, Te Rapa Parish, across
Tahi Street, and through portion of Section 8, Te Rapa
Parish, to the No. 2 factory in the said Section 8. As the
same is more particularly delineated on the plan marked
P.W.D. 51419, deposited in the office of the Minister of Public
Works at Wellington, in the Land District of Wellington, and
thereon indicated by a broken red line. - SYSTEM OF SUPPLY.
The system of supply shall be as described in paragraph (c)
of clause 3 of the regulations.
The generating voltage shall be approximately 400 volts
between the terminals. - DATUM TEMPERATURE.
For the purpose of calculating the stresses as provided in
clause 15 of the regulations, the datum temperature shall be
taken as 20 degrees Fahrenheit. - DURATION OF LICENSE.
This license shall, unless sooner determined in accordance
with the provisions hereinafter expressed, continue in force
for a period of forty-two years from the date hereof. Upon
the expiry of the said term, or upon the sooner determination
of this license by revocation or otherwise, all rights hereby
granted to the licensee shall thereupon cease and determine;
but such expiration or determination shall not relieve the
licensee of any liability theretofore incurred under this license.
B - REQUIREMENTS OF HAMILTON BOROUGH COUNCIL.
Notwithstanding anything hereinbefore contained, the
licensee shall not be entitled to erect, maintain, or use any
electric lines within the Hamilton Borough except subject to
such conditions, not inconsistent with the provisions of this
license and the regulations relating thereto, or any variation
of this license or the regulations, or new regulations which
may take the place of these regulations, as may from time to
time be agreed upon between the licensee and the Hamilton
Borough Council. - VARIATION IN CONDITIONS OF LICENSE.
The terms and conditions of this license may at any time
or from time to time, at the request or with the consent in
writing of the licensee, be altered by the Governor-General
by Order in Council. - BARE WIRES.
Notwithstanding anything herein contained, no bare wire
shall be erected until the consent in writing of the Minister
has been obtained thereto, in accordance with the regulations.
C. A. JEFFERY,
Acting Clerk of the Executive Council.
Order in Council confirming Scheme of Consolidation of
Interests in various Blocks of Native Land.
JELLICOE, Governor-General.
ORDER IN COUNCIL.
At the Government House at Wellington, this 12th day of
September, 1921.
Present:
HIS EXCELLENCY THE GOVERNOR-GENERAL IN COUNCIL.
WHEREAS it is enacted by section one hundred and
thirty (hereinafter referred to as “the said section”)
of the Native Land Act, 1909, that the Governor-General, if
satisfied that any scheme of consolidation of interests of
owners in any specified area or areas of Native land duly
submitted to him under the provisions of the said section is
just and equitable and is in the public interest, may by Order
in Council confirm such scheme:
And whereas, upon the application of the Native Minister,
the Waiariki District Native Land Court prepared a scheme
of consolidation of interests of owners in the blocks of the
Native land mentioned in the Schedule hereto, and submitted
the same on the third day of April, one thousand nine hundred
and seventeen, under the seal of the Court, to the Governor-
General for his approval:
And whereas the Governor-General is satisfied that such
scheme as submitted to him is just and equitable and is in
the public interest:
Now, therefore, His Excellency the Governor-General of
the Dominion of New Zealand, acting by and with the advice
and consent of the Executive Council thereof, and in exercise
of the powers conferred upon him by the said section, doth
hereby confirm the said scheme of consolidation of interests
of owners in the blocks of Native land mentioned in the
Schedule hereto.
SCHEDULE.
HOROHORO SURVEY DISTRICT.
Block Area
Anakiwi No. 7 .. .. .. 0 0 15·1
Waikite No. 2 .. .. .. 0 0 28
,, No. 5 .. .. .. 0 0 12·2
Omarukaipua No. 2 .. .. 0 1 24·5
,, No. 3 .. .. .. 0 1 10
,, No. 4 .. .. .. 0 2 29·4
,, No. 5 .. .. .. 1 1 22·7
Harakekeroa C No. 3 .. .. 0 3 29
Ririnui No. 3 .. .. .. 0 0 23·5
Tapuaepirikohatu No. 2A .. .. 0 0 22
C. A. JEFFERY,
Acting Clerk of the Executive Council.
